Constructed some twenty years ago, the office building at 258 Bath Road, Slough comprises three storeys, split into east and west with a central core. SEGRO occupy the first floor east and the whole of the second floor, and Furniture Village occupy the ground floor west.

Watkins Payne have provided building services engineering to refurbish the ground floor east comprising 3,477ft² and the first floor west comprising 7,088ft².

As the existing mechanical and electrical services were in good condition, only a light touch was needed to extend the building’s M&E serviceable life for another ten years. The on-floor VAV system was overhauled and provides the offices with cooled or heated air controlled by the air handling units located at roof level. The new ceiling grid introduced into the office space has been provided with energy efficient LED luminaires.
